Tweet 3/5
The split-brain problem and fencing
This is the thing that took GitHub down. And it's the most dangerous failure mode in leader election.
How split-brain happens:
1. Leader (Node A) is running fine
2. Network partition isolates Node A from the rest of the cluster
3. Nodes B, C, D, E can't hear Node A's heartbeats
4. They elect a new leader: Node B
5. But Node A is still alive. It doesn't know it's been replaced. It still thinks it's the leader.
Now you have two leaders. Both accepting writes. Both making decisions. Clients connected to Node A write one thing. Clients connected to Node B write something different. Data diverges.
When the partition heals and both nodes compare notes, you have conflicting data that's extremely hard to reconcile.
How to prevent it: fencing
Fencing means making absolutely sure the old leader can't do any damage after a new leader is elected.
Fencing token: every time a new leader is elected, it gets a monotonically increasing token number. Any operation includes this token. If a storage system receives a request with an old token (from the deposed leader), it rejects it. The old leader's requests simply stop working.
STONITH (Shoot The Other Node In The Head): physically power off or network-isolate the old leader. Sounds extreme. It is. But when the alternative is split-brain with financial data, physically killing the old leader is the safe option.
Lease-based leadership: the leader holds a time-limited lease (say 10 seconds). It must renew the lease before it expires. If the leader is partitioned and can't renew, the lease expires and it knows it's no longer the leader. It stops accepting writes voluntarily.
This is what most cloud-native systems use. It's simpler than fencing tokens and handles most cases. The downside: there's a brief window (the lease duration) where no leader exists during a transition.
The GitHub fix: they implemented better orchestration tooling (using Orchestrator) that prevents the old primary from accepting writes when a new primary is promoted. Essentially automated fencing.

GitHub, October 2018. A network partition lasted 43 seconds and caused a 24 hour outage.
The MySQL cluster panicked. Elected a new primary. The old primary didn't get the memo.
Two leaders. Both accepting writes. Both convinced they were the source of truth.
By the time the partition healed, the data had diverged so badly that GitHub's engineers spent the next 24 hours manually reconciling commits, pull requests, and webhook deliveries.
